NCR Corp. (NCR) Tops Q1 EPS by 4c

April 27, 2021 4:10 PM EDT

NCR Corp. (NYSE: NCR) reported Q1 EPS of $0.51, $0.04 better than the analyst estimate of $0.47. Revenue for the quarter came in at $1.54 billion versus the consensus estimate of $1.54 billion.

First quarter and other recent highlights include:

  • Revenue of $1,544 million, up 3%; Recurring revenue up 9%
  • Significant profit margin expansion driven by cost reductions and favorable mix of revenue
  • Cash flow from operations of $155 million; Free cash flow of $98 million, up $118 million
  • GAAP diluted EPS of $0.19; Non-GAAP diluted EPS of $0.51, up 65%

“Our first quarter results represent a great start to the year with increased momentum in our shift to NCR-as-a-Service,” said Michael Hayford, President and Chief Executive Officer. “Our performance included strong recurring revenue growth, margin expansion and cash flow generation. We are benefiting from the successful execution of our strategy and are a stronger company than we were a year ago. We are confident our strategy will drive accelerated profitable growth and deliver long-term value creation for stockholders. Our financial position is strong, and our proposed transaction with Cardtronics remains on track for a mid-year 2021 close, subject to regulatory and Cardtroncs' shareholder approval.”
